Dutch intelligence: Russian state hackers target Signal and WhatsApp accounts
Mar 9th 2026
Dutch intelligence services say hackers impersonate support bots to steal verification codes and seize accounts of officials, military personnel, journalists and others, and they urge users to verify contacts and remove compromised accounts.
- Dutch AIVD and MIVD confirmed Russian state actors are attempting to access Signal and WhatsApp accounts worldwide.
- Attackers impersonate Signal support chatbots to obtain verification codes and PINs.
- Hijacked accounts can be read, used to join group chats, and linked to devices for remote surveillance.
- Agencies say the campaign targets individual accounts rather than vulnerabilities in the messaging apps.
- AIVD and MIVD warned that end to end encrypted apps are not suitable for classified information.
- Advisory: verify suspicious or duplicate accounts, report concerns to IT, remove compromised accounts from groups, and recreate groups if an administrator is compromised.
